Hi, and welcome to the rotation. Most support tickets touching staging data trace back to Fixtureforge, our test-data factory library. It seeds accounts, orders, and invoices for every staging environment nightly. If a seed job fails, the dashboard shows the offending factory and a retry button — don't re-run the whole pipeline. Common failure modes are schema mismatches after migrations and exhausted ID pools. Troubleshooting steps, factory definitions, and escalation notes are all documented on the internal page below:

wiki page, yajep-fajog: https://confluence.torvahq.local/ticket/display/dash/settings/merge_requests/ticket/run/a3215cc5a3d8263468d4c885

### Runbook: Fernbach ORM refactor — security review step

The legacy Marlow ORM layer is being replaced with parameterized query builders; raw string interpolation paths are removed module by module. Reviewers should verify no remaining dynamic SQL in the ledger and invoicing modules, then confirm audit logging still fires on writes. The review applies to the build recorded here:

session token of yajof-bagef = htk4_937d

Alert: Hullcast schema registry rejecting event registrations. Fires when the rejection rate exceeds 5% over 10 minutes. Common causes: incompatible schema evolution (field removal without default), stale producer cache, or registry node restart mid-deploy. Do not disable compatibility checks. Restarting producers usually clears cache issues; evolution conflicts need a schema fix from the owning team. Escalate to the Marroway platform rotation if rejections persist past 30 minutes. Triage steps and ownership map here:

wiki page, tawif-yawig: https://confluence.zemvarsys.internal/display/display/browse/display

Welcome to the Sornette search team. Your first task concerns the autocomplete index, which has been rebuilding slowly since the Kettlevale migration. Profiling suggests the tokenizer stage is the bottleneck, so start there. To query the index metrics service and pull timing histograms, you'll authenticate against the internal Brimward endpoint using the key provided below.

app token of yagaf-bahop = vxb2-4d